How to handle insane LAGs?
I have two questions about LAG idiots.
Background: I played a game where a player would go all in pre-flop in any position if no one else had entered the pot or if there were only limpers ahead of him. Not all the time, maybe 25% of the time.
It was only a matter of time, of course, but I only saw a showdown with A9s (he got lucky) and 66 (he lost to 99). I have a feeling he shoved with any pp or any A.
My strategy with these bozos is to let them donk themselves out unless I have AA or KK. I folded JJ when he did this one time. I don't think AK is strong enough. If the donkey is short stacked, my calling (isolating) requirements are lower, of course.
Questions:
1. Is my strategy appropriate or too conservative? I saw 99 call and bust him out when he had 66. Are QQ and JJ suitable for calling?
